    Drywall repair was not explained to me when the company did the plumbing repair. The repair person showed me the contract after the work was done with the disclaimer not responsible for drywall repair. I ask to speak to the manager or owner, they told me I will get a phone call back. I never heard from anyone from the company. The company do have bathroom and kitchen remodeling services and I offered to pay for the drywall repair if they come back and complete the service at a later date, but the customer service agent said they do not do drywall repair.

    Business Response

    Date: 06/21/2024

    Our tech was there for service sunday august 14 2022 for a leaking sill c*** the drywall needed to be removed for access to saffely compleat the work. We do not do drywall repairs nor do we have anyone working for us that does as it appears the coustmer was told when they called to inquire about this. The coustmer should have been told about this when the tec did work that we do not repair drywall. Being almost two years since the work was compleated it's hard to put compleat info together.We are sorry for any inconvinence this may have been for the coustmer and I beleive per his complaint that this is what he was told when he called our office even though we do kitchen and bath remodels the drywall if required is subed out for that work thanks Super Rooter
